Trans Scientist Sues Trump Administration Over '2 Sexes' Order · NDTV

A transgender woman named Sarah O'Neill, who works as a scientist for the NSA, is suing the Trump administration.

She is upset about an order from President Trump that says there are only two sexes: male and female.

Sarah says this order and other rules at her workplace make her feel unwelcome and are against the law.

She wants the court to stop these rules and let her use the women's restroom and identify as female at work.

The Supreme Court has said that discrimination against transgender people is against the law, and Sarah's lawyers are using this to argue her case.

Quotes

US Supreme Court

The highest court in the United States

“We agree that homosexuality and transgender status are distinct concepts from sex. But, as we’ve seen, discrimination based on homosexuality or transgender status necessarily entails discrimination based on sex; the first cannot happen without the second.”
